- This invention concerns the mechanism of closing of mould, especially of blowing machine with use of crank mechanism with rotational servo-motor.
- the servo-drive drives the shaft of closing of mould which is connected with the pair of the drive cranks. Rotation of these cranks causes the motion of arms of closing of moulds and thus also the motion of handles of closing of moulds. The motion of arms of closing of moulds around the circle causes the closing and open of clamping boards and the mould.
- the main advantage of the described solution is the reduction of demands on power drive up to 75 %.
- the related benefits are considerable decrease of drive price and the optimalized cinematics of this mechanism, also suitable build dimensions from the point of view of possibility of follow-up mechanisms' connection of machine and of peripheral devices.

- Servo-drive 1 is fixed to one side 3 of closing of mould and it is connected with the shaft 2 of the mould closing which is tightly connected by the help of springs with the pair of drive cranks 7. These cranks 7 are connected with the arms 8 of the closing of moulds and also with the handles 9 of closing of moulds.
- the arm 8 of closing of moulds and handle 9 of closing of moulds are connected by the help of pivots 4 and 5 and connecting rod 6 with the thread for setting and synchronization of the motion of both halves of mould.
- the servo-drive 1 drives the shaft 2 of closing of mould which is connected with the pair of the drive cranks 7. Rotation of these cranks 7 causes the motion of arms 8 of closing of moulds and thus also the motion of handles 9 of closing of moulds. The motion of arms 8 of closing of moulds around the circle causes the closing and open of clamping boards K) and the mould 11.
- This technical solution is usable especially for blowing machines.
